Jomari Yllana shifts into high gear for road safety at Motorsport Carnivale

Racing meets advocacy on May 31 as Parañaque City Councilor Jomari Yllana takes the lead not just on the track, but on the call for safer roads across the country.

Known for his dual roles as public servant and Team Principal of Yllana Racing, Yllana is placing road safety at the heart of the Okada Motorsport Carnivale Jom’s Cup, a motorsport event happening at Okada Manila.

Yllana recently appeared on Radyo 630 Teleradyo Serbisyo, where he addressed the alarming rise in traffic incidents. He stressed the urgent need for better safeguards, saying, “In the wake of a growing number of accidents on our roads lately, stricter measures must be put in place to safeguard pedestrians and motorists alike.”

More than just a showcase of speed and skill, Yllana emphasized that the May 31 event carries a deeper mission.“Road safety,” he said, “is at the core of [my] motivation for staging the Okada Motorsport Carnivale Jom’s Cup on May 31, 2025, at Okada Manila.”

By fusing the thrill of motorsports with a call for responsible driving, Yllana hopes to create not just excitement, but awareness—proving that advocacy can move just as fast as the cars on the track.

Jom’s Cup is a high-octane 1/8 mile drag racing challenge, featuring vintage cars, muscle cars, and supercars. The action will unfold at the scenic seaside boardwalk of Okada Manila, offering both thrill and nostalgia.

The Okada Motorsport Carnivale 2025 officially launched on May 4 with a dynamic lineup of motorsport events held at the boardwalk and gardens of the expansive hotel-casino complex in Parañaque City.

The opening event—Round 3 of the Super Sprint series—saw 127 drivers race through challenging slalom courses, cheered on by over 700 spectators. As the sun set, the event shifted gears with “Legends of the ’90s,” a grand vintage car meet that gathered 365 classic vehicles, some dating as far back as the 1960s.

More than a thousand car enthusiasts came together to witness the impressive showcase of design, engineering, and power—a celebration of automotive heritage like no other.

On his road safety advocacy, Yllana assured the public of the event’s strict safety protocols: “It is going to be very, very safe. We take care of everyone who will join. We conduct briefings before the races. All the races are designed to be safe.”

Yllana, who has been passionate about motorsports since his teenage years, said organizing the Motorsport Carnivale is his way of giving back to the sport that shaped him.
